The Department of Healthcare and Family Services is seeking an organized, professional and results oriented individual to serve as the Chief Labor Relations Officer. This position will plan, direct, evaluate, and oversee staff in the Labor Relations Office. This position reports to the HR Administrator and represents the agency as spokesperson relative to labor relations policies and procedures, grievance proceedings, unfair labor practice complaints, and in mediation or arbitration hearings. At the Illinois Department of Healthcare and Family Services (HFS), We value staff as our greatest asset at the Illinois Department of Healthcare and Family Services (HFS). We work in a spirit of teamwork to help millions of Illinoisans access high-quality healthcare and fulfill child support obligations to advance their physical, mental, and financial well-being. We provide healthcare coverage for children and adults through Medicaid and other medical programs, and we help ensure that children receive financial resources from both their parents through Child Support Services. The HFS Office of the Inspector General investigates, audits and reviews program activity to ensure the integrity of our programs is maintained.
